Key Market Indicators

Chilean blood and blood forming organs medicine sales are expected to reach $234 million by 2026, growing at an average annual rate of 3%, according to a new report. Since 2005, the Chilean market has increased by 5.3% year-on-year. In 2021, Chile ranked 21st, with Hungary overtaking Chile's $190.7 million. Germany, Italy, and South Korea were ranked second, third, and fourth, respectively. Chilean anemia prevalence is expected to reach 6,730 hospital discharges by 2026, growing at an average annual rate of 0.7%. Since 2006, Chilean demand has decreased by 2.2%. In 2021, Chile ranked 20th, with Ireland overtaking Chile's 6,020 hospital discharges. Germany, the United Kingdom, and Poland were ranked second, third, and fourth, respectively.
